Christians Families Kicked Out of Community

[237] prayers in [17] nations have been posted for Exiled Families.

Several families have been kicked out of a village in eastern Oaxaca state because of their Christian faith. The traditional religion of the village honors pagan idols through drunken festivals, and the Christian families refused to participate in the festivals. As a result, some of the Christians were arrested by the village authorities, and the families were driven from their community. The families are currently staying in their pastor’s house.
